About this listen
The No. 1 ebook bestseller, Sunday Times Top 10 bestseller and USA Today bestseller
The real nightmare starts when her daughter is returned…
A girl is missing. Five years old, taken from outside her school. She has vanished, traceless.
The police are at a loss; her parents are beyond grief. Their daughter is lost forever, perhaps dead, perhaps enslaved.
But the biggest mystery is yet to come: one week after she was abducted, their daughter is returned.
She has no memory of where she has been. And this, for her mother, is just the beginning of the nightmare.

Predictable
I don't know what made it more cringeworthy for me - the narrator's "evil" narration was a combination of Sesame Street's Count Dracula and Mike Myers' Dr Evil. Unlistenable. Or the immediately predictable story. I loathe the main character, Julia, for being so dumb and not realizing what was going on as soon as I did - which was about a chapter into the story.
Save your money. There are better books and narrators out there.
